MHS survives MCS’ gallant stand

Defending champion Marianas High School rallied in the second set to survive Mt. Carmel School’s gallant effort in yesterday’s final match in the 2014-2015 Marianas Interscholastic Sports Organization Girls Volleyball League at the MHS Gymnasium. The MHS Lady Dolphins came back...

Dream Team seals semis berth

Dream Team clinched the second semis berth in the boys U19 division of the 2014 Tan Holdings Basketball Classic, following a 70-47 trouncing of the Ol’Aces last night at the Gillette Multipurpose Gymnasium. Dream Team now has a 4-2 record for second place, while the Ol’Aces fell...

MTEC gathers elementary kids to talk tourism

Marianas Tourism Education Council gathered elementary school students from all over the island for the first day of their 2015 Tourism Summit at the Saipan World Resort yesterday. The summit drew 343 students, according to MTEC chairwoman Vicky Benavente. “We are not only giving...

United to serve premium-cabin dining experience on North America flights

CHICAGO—United Airlines will treat premium-cabin customers on flights within North America to a brand new dining experience beginning Feb. 1, when the airline elevates everything from entrées to desserts and lighter snacks for United First and United Business customers....
